Game 1: “Stop the bus”
10
powerpoint
Optional
- Divide the class into 2 groups
to play the game: Stop the bus.
- Explain the rules of the game:
Everybody has a quick look at
picture and call out the words.
When they have the answers,
they will have to say “stop the
bus” quickly to get the right to
answer the question. The group
whose members say “stop the
bus” first will answer the
question by saying aloud the
words of the pictures they see.
- Wait for SS' answer, help
him/her correct it and reads the
words aloud for the whole class
to listen and repeat.
- Give Ss 10 points for a correct
answer. The group with more
points at the end will win the
game.

Activity 3: Practice (10 minutes)
Teacher's activities
Task 8: Listen and chant. (Track 1.13)
-Tell students they are going to learn a
chant. Explain to students that the chant
uses the sounds they have just learnt.
Student's activities
- Listen to the teacher.
16
-Play the recording and tell students to
listen and follow the words with their
-Point and repeat.
fingers.
-Read out the chant one line at a time and
ask students to repeat after you.
-Play the recording again. Encourage
students to chant along. Practise several
-Chant along.
times until students are familiar with the
words and sounds.
-Ask students to practise the chant
- Practice in pairs.
individually, and then in pairs or in
groups. For example, one group chants
the first verse, and the other group chants
the second verse. Ask some volunteers to
chant (optional).
